WebDogs with chocolate poisoning may initially be sick, have stomach pain or an upset stomach. Theobromine is a stimulant, so it can cause your dog to become excitable or develop muscle twitching, tremors, fitting or they may have a high heart rate. Other signs can include drinking a lot, dribbling, not walking in a straight line and fast breathing. Sucralose Sold under the brand name Splenda, sucralose holds up well in baked goods, and it can be found in diet beverages and other items. It’s not toxic to pets, but there is evidence that overconsumption can lead to gastrointestinal upset. What sweetener is poisonous to dogs? No. Though Splenda isn’t considered to be toxic to dogs, it isn’t good for them at all. Just because they can eat it and live, doesn’t mean that they’ll enjoy the stomach ache that comes shortly afterward.
